Understanding Business Liability Insurance: Coverage and Why It's Essential
Business Liability Insurance is a crucial coverage for any business, protecting against potential risks and legal liabilities that may arise in operations. This type of insurance provides financial safeguard against claims of bodily injury or property damage to third parties, including customers, employees, and visitors on your premises. It’s not just about settling lawsuits; it also helps businesses manage medical expenses, legal fees, and other associated costs during the claims process.
Business Insurance Providers offer various coverage options tailored to different business needs. General Liability Insurance, for instance, covers common risks like slip-and-fall accidents or product liability. Professional Liability Insurance, on the other hand, protects against claims of negligence or malpractice in services provided. Understanding these coverages is essential for businesses to make informed decisions when choosing a provider.

Comparing Policies: What to Look for in Liability Coverage
When comparing business insurance providers and their liability coverage, it’s crucial to scrutinize several key factors. Look for policies that offer broad protection against common risks specific to your industry, such as property damage, personal injury, and legal expenses arising from lawsuits. Check the limits of liability, which represent the maximum amount an insurer will pay out under a claim; higher limits provide better financial safeguard for your business.
Additionally, evaluate the policy’s exclusions and conditions carefully. Note any limitations or circumstances not covered by the insurance, as these can vary significantly among providers. How to Assess an Insurance Provider's Reliability and Stability
When evaluating business insurance providers, assessing their reliability and stability is a crucial step in ensuring adequate protection for your company. Start by checking the provider’s financial strength ratings from independent agencies like A.M. Best or Moody’s. These ratings indicate the insurer’s ability to meet their obligations over time. Next, review the provider’s history and track record. Look for years of operation, any changes in ownership, and their standing with regulatory bodies.
Additionally, consider customer reviews and testimonials from other businesses they’ve insured. Check if there have been significant complaints or claims against them.
